Closed: Kansas City, Kansas Section 8 Voucher

The Kansas City Kansas Housing Authority (KCKHA) last accepted Section 8 Housing Choice Voucher waiting list applications from August 30, 2023, until September 1, 2023. There is no notice when this waiting list will reopen.

To apply while the waitlist was open, applicants were required to complete the online application.

This waiting list had the following preferences:

  • Foster Youth to Independence (FYI)
    • Referred by a service provider to serve youth under the age of 25 with a history of child welfare involvement.
  • Working Families
    • Families where the head, spouse or sole member is employed. However, an applicant shall be given the benefit of the working family preference if the head and spouse, or sole member is age 62 or older, or is a person with disabilities.
  • Local Residency
    • A Resident of Kansas City, Kansas with a current valid I.D., current utility bill, or current lease.
  • Homeless
    • certification from a public or private facility that provides shelter or from the local police department or social service provider.
  • Victim of Domestic Violence
    • Police/Court reports, Protection Order, or social service agency.
  • Military
    • Veterans or Surviving spouses of Veterans and Active Personnel with a DD214 and or honorable discharge.

2000 selected applicants were placed on the waiting list by random lottery, by order of preferences.

About Kansas City Kansas Housing Authority

1124 North 9th Street, Kansas City, KS | Visit Website | (913) 281-3300

Kansas City Kansas Housing Authority provides affordable housing for up to 3,700 low and moderate income households through its Section 8 Housing Choice Voucher (HCV) and Public Housing programs..

In addition, Kansas City Kansas Housing Authority offers other programs for eligible households, including:

  • Homeownership Voucher
  • Public Housing Homeownership
  • Veteran Affairs Supportive Housing (VASH)
  • Mainstream Voucher

Housing Authority Jurisdiction

Low-income housing managed by Kansas City Kansas Housing Authority is located in Kansas City, KS.

Households with a Section 8 Housing Choice Voucher managed by this housing authority must rent within its jurisdiction.
